As i'm using vMix in an integrated system, piloted by its API, I encountered a problem with the vMix API.

I am using Program AND Preview to make 2 distincts video feeds, each with its overlays and different video sources.

In the vMix API, I can activate or desactivate an overlay for Program output with the command OverlayInput1On and OverlayInput1Off. It is therefore stateless, if I say "off" and it's already off, it doesn't reactivate.

But concerning overlays on the preview output, the commands are only PreviewOverlayInput1. So it toggles the overlay, but I can't know in which state it is. With the latrency created by my system (UI on an iPad in wifi), I can't rely on the state given by the API feedback...

Could the vMix team add the stateless commands PreviewOverlayInput1On and PreviewOverlayInput1Off (for the 4 overlays of course!) in the next vMix release?
